Malvachimica - Depends on the day ***
Three elements make up the Malvachimica. Three teens from the Tuscan province at its debut with the ep depends on the day. A watercolor in brilliant colors, suspended between hope and truth. Five snapshots sung with grit and talent, "real" songs and "feel" not to pass up. It starts with Malcomune that immediately reminded me of the Dropkick Murphys, then continue to speak with larks , Melancholy and yearning, with a nice guitar crescendo, then continue with Vineyards , almost folk, with a text govanile, a very cool pop song. Then Uncle of America, turn toward rock sound and darker. Finally Island , very rhythmic, it reminded me of something like Heroes del silencio or fear. Really interesting this debut Malvachimica mixes genres with a good dose of originality. Marco Colombo

Mirror Man - Stars of rust **
Leonardo (vocals, guitar), Luke (drums), Paul (bass) and Stephen (harmonica) formed the Mirror Man, a band featuring sounds that draw on the group's own admission with references ranging from Tom Waits to Tim Burton, from Kurt Weil to David Bowie to Nick Cave. The lyrics are in Italian, however. Thin, antivirtuosistica, the music of Mirror Man would be full of feeling, signs of disseminated Expressionists extracted from the cylinder of a tragic comedian. So are defined in the explanatory note, description, some of which share listening to the record, the third band. The texts deal with different themes: loneliness, separation, love, death, the dream ... They deserve a listen, while not shining in the list of my personal liking. Marco Colombo
